  • Patent number: 6265514
    Abstract: Poly(siloxane-acrylate) elastomers with low weep characteristics are formed by the steps of: (A) forming an amine functional alkenyl-containing siloxane by mixing and heating: (a) a polydiorganosiloxane, (b) an amino-functional silane hydrolyzate, (c) an alkenylorganosiloxane, and (d) a base equilibration catalyst, then (B) reacting, at room temperature, the amine functional alkenyl-containing siloxane with an acrylate to form a curable alkenyl-containing poly(siloxane-acrylate) with oxycarbonylethyleneimino-containing organic groups, and (C) curing the alkenyl-containing poly(siloxane-acrylate) to form an poly(siloxane-acrylate) elastomer.

  • Patent number: 5777047
    Abstract: Organosiloxane compositions curable to silicone elastomers having improved weep properties are described. The compositions include an alkenyl-containing polydiorganosiloxane, an organohydrogensiloxane, a platinum-group metal catalyst and a MQ-type resinous organosiloxane copolymer having at least one fluorine atom-containing group per molecule; and a silicone elastomer prepared from such composition. A method of minimizing the leakage of a hydrocarbon fluid from a container using the silicone elastomer is also described.

  • Patent number: 5756598
    Abstract: Organosiloxane compositions curable to silicone elastomers having improved weep properties are described. The compositions include an alkenyl-containing polydiorganosiloxane, an organohydrogensiloxane, a platinum-group metal catalyst and a MQ-type resinous organosiloxane copolymer; and a silicone elastomer prepared from such composition. A method of a minimizing the leakage of a hydrocarbon fluid from a container using the silicone elastomer is also described.
